How much do senior desktop support eng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 6, 2026, the average yearly pay for senior desktop support engineer in Colorado is $108,584.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$85,700.00 and $130,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a senior desktop support engineer?

Senior Desktop Support Engineers are experienced IT professionals who provide advanced technical support for computer systems, software, and hardware within an organization. They handle complex issues that junior technicians cannot resolve, maintain and troubleshoot desktops, laptops, and peripherals, and ensure users have minimal downtime. In addition to direct support, they may also manage IT projects, implement new technologies, and mentor junior staff. Their role is critical in maintaining the productivity and security of a company’s IT environ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ior desktop support engineer?

To thrive as a Senior Desktop Support Engineer, you need extensive experience in troubleshooting hardware and software issues, a strong understanding of operating systems, and typically a degree in IT or related certifications like CompTIA A+ or Microsoft Certified Solutions Expert (MCSE). Familiarity with remote management tools, ticketing systems (such as ServiceNow), and enterprise security protocols is crucial. Exceptional problem-solving abilities, communication skills, and a customer-focused attitude help you excel in supporting users and collaborating with IT teams. These skills ensure rapid issue resolution, minimize downtime, and maintain smooth business operations.

What are some common challenges faced by senior desktop support engineers, and how can they effectively address them?

Senior Desktop Support Engineers often encounter challenges such as managing complex technical issues across multiple platforms, balancing a high volume of support requests, and staying current with rapidly evolving technologies. Effective problem-solving, prioritization, and strong communication skills are essential for addressing these challenges. Additionally, collaborating closely with IT teams and proactively documenting solutions can streamline workflows and enhance overall support efficiency.

What is the difference between Senior Desktop Support Engineer vs Desktop Support Technician?

AspectSenior Desktop Support EngineerDesktop Support Technician
Required CredentialsTypically requires certifications like CompTIA A+, Microsoft Certified Desktop Support Technician (MCDST), or equivalent experienceUsually requires CompTIA A+ or similar entry-level certifications
Work EnvironmentSupports complex hardware/software issues, often in corporate or enterprise settingsHandles basic troubleshooting, hardware setup, and user support in various environments
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in IT departments of large organizations, government, and enterprise sectorsFound in small to medium businesses, educational institutions, and retail

The main difference between a Senior Desktop Support Engineer and a Desktop Support Technician lies in experience, complexity of tasks, and certifications. Senior Engineers handle more advanced issues and often mentor junior staff, while Technicians focus on routine support and basic troubleshooting.

Typical Day in the Life

As the Support Engineer for our Denver office you will provide onsite technical support. Analyze and troubleshoot computer support problems and apply understanding of computer software and hardware products to resolve problems for end users. Maintain office hardware and software inventories.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Provides excellent technical assistance and desktop support to end users at our Denver, Boulder, Fort Collins, and Grand Junction locations.
  • Installs, modifies, and repairs computer hardware and software.
  • Troubleshoots computer systems and/or printer hardware issues.
  • Troubleshoots software issues.
  • Troubleshoots miscellaneous network and server issues.
  • Asks questions to determine nature of the problem.
  • Walks end users through the problem-solving process.
  • Documents end users queries, problems, and solutions.
  • Follows up with end users to ensure issue has been resolved.
  • Provides onsite support for Help Desk in a multi-location office.
  • Maintains office hardware and software inventories.
  • Serves as a back-up resource for the Help Desk call center.
  • Ensures timely and accurate performance on assigned projects.
  • Maintains compliance with project budgets, turnaround times, and deadlines.

Physical Requirements:

  • Requires prolonged sitting, some bending, stooping and stretching.
  • Requires hand-eye coordination and manual dexterity sufficient to operate a keyboard, photocopier, telephone, calculator and other office equipment.
  • Hearing must be in the normal range for telephone contacts.
  • Requires the ability to lift up to 20 lbs.
  • Prompt and dependable attendance.

Who You Are

  • Associate’s Degree in Information Systems, Computer Science, or related field. An equivalent combination of education and experience may be substituted.
  • 2-4 years of experience with Microsoft products.
  • 2-4 years of experience with PC hardware.
  • Advanced knowledge of Microsoft Windows and Microsoft Office.
  • Working knowledge PC and printer hardware.
  • Outstanding customer service skills.
  • Proven problem solving and troubleshooting abilities and attention to detail.
  • Ability to communicate clearly in writing and verbally.
  • Ability to work independently with minimal supervision.
  • Ability to work on multiple projects and meet deadlines by setting priorities with work projects.
  •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ships with co-workers and clients.
